Subject: | bug#36961: Can't use microphone in ungoogled-chromium |

> I can confirm that removing audio_capture_enabled from
> master_preferences.json solves this issue. Fix pushed in
> 5ee1c0459eebdd3b7771abaeab0f0b52ff86fdd5.
>
> For existing Chromium profiles, you will need to close all browser
> windows and run
>
> sed -i 's/"audio_capture_enabled":false/"audio_capture_enabled":true/' \
> ~/.config/chromium/Default/Preferences
>
> ...to get the new default.
